Ather Energy has commenced 2025 by unveiling new additions to its 450 Series of electric scooters. The lineup features the Ather 450X, 450S, and 450 Apex, each equipped with significant enhancements. Ather 450 Series: Price & Availability

  • Ather 450S with 2.9kWh battery is priced at Rs. 1,19,999. It comes in four colors.
  • Ather 450X with 2.9kWh battery is priced at Rs. 1,46,999. It comes in seven colors.
  • Ather 450X with a 3.7kWh battery is priced at Rs. 1,56,999. It comes in seven colors.
  • Ather 450 Apex is priced at Rs. 2 lakh.

The pre-booking can be done by paying Rs. 2500 online or offline.

Ather 450 Series 2025: Upgrades

The 2025 lineup of Ather scooters features an advanced multi-mode traction control system. This system is engineered to regulate rear wheel slippage during quick acceleration, particularly on low-friction surfaces. It offers three distinct modes:

  • Rain Mode, emphasizes stability in wet conditions by implementing the most stringent torque intervention and restricting acceleration.
  • Road Mode is the default setting. It aims to balance safety and performance for everyday riding scenarios.
  • Rally Mode offers the least intrusive torque intervention and the fastest ramp backup. This mode is for uneven or challenging terrain.

The 2025 series introduces the Magic Twist feature, enabling riders to slow down by twisting the throttle backward, which activates regenerative braking to assist in recharging the battery. Additionally, the range for all models has been increased.

The 450S now provides a range of 122 km, while the 450X with a 2.9 kWh battery offers 126 km, and the 450X with a 3.7 kWh battery extends the range to 161 km. Charging times have also been updated, with the 450S requiring 7 hours and 45 minutes to charge, and the 450X taking 4 hours and 30 minutes.

The 2025 Ather series is equipped with Atherstack 6, the newest iteration of the company’s software platform. This version features WhatsApp integration on the dashboard, Alexa compatibility, the Ping My Scooter function, and app updates that provide ride statistics, real-time notifications, and additional enhancements.

Ather has introduced two new color options: Hyper Sand and Stealth Blue. Hyper Sand is exclusively available for the 450X model, whereas Stealth Blue can be chosen for both models. The 2025 Ather lineup is backed by the new Eight70 warranty, which provides coverage for up to 8 years or 80,000 kilometers, along with 70% battery capacity.
